**14:22** — Autocomplete latency on Harrowmere search climbed past 900ms p95. On-call confirmed the suggestion index had not compacted since the morning deploy; segment count was roughly six times normal. Manual compaction was triggered at 14:31 and latency recovered by 14:40. Root cause traced to a scheduler misconfiguration introduced in the deploy. The offending deploy is identified by the token recorded below.

pipeline stamp: htk31_f769b577b3028a4e9958e5bb8d1259a

The FeeForge rules engine, which computes shipping fees for Marlowe Mercantile checkouts, is intermittently failing to reach its rules database since the 14:20 deploy. Symptoms: pool acquisition timeouts every few minutes, fee evaluation falling back to cached rules. Restarting the service clears it for roughly an hour. Suspect a leaked connection in the new tier-lookup path. On-call: please enable pool tracing and capture a leak report. Use the staging database via the connection string below.

replica DSN, kagaf-kajef: postgresql://eliius_svc:UA@db-a408.paliqnet.internal:5432/istys

Step 3: Wire up cache invalidation for the Copperleaf catalog. Here's the gist: whenever a product row changes, the Thistledown sync job publishes an invalidation event, and each app node drops the matching cache entry. Don't be tempted to just shorten the TTL — we tried that and stale prices showed up during the Brindlemoor launch. Make sure your local node subscribes to the event channel before serving traffic. The sync job connects to the database listed below.

replica DSN, yahaf-yagaf: mongodb://tamath_svc:a2netSk3RZMuTj@db-d084.novacsoft.internal:5432/ralmir

19:47 — Turnstile counters at the Harwick Dome north gates began double-counting entries after the Gatefold aggregator restarted mid-match. Attendance dashboards showed roughly 2x actual throughput for eleven minutes. On-call disabled the aggregator's replay queue, flushed duplicate events, and reconciled counts against the handheld scanner logs. Gate operations were never blocked; only reporting was affected. Root cause is a replay-offset bug in the aggregator, fixed in the build noted below.

session token of tajef-bageg = htk21_5d90d574934f3ccae6437